Traffic stop leads troopers to find woman with multiple injuries hiding in back of husband's commercial truck

CANTON, Ohio — A traffic stop in Canton led state troopers to arrest a truck driver after his wife was found hiding in the cab of his truck with multiple injuries, according to a release from the Ohio State Highway Patrol.

Kenny R. Roberts, 45, of Ironton, who was impaired at the time of the traffic stop, was charged with multiple felonies including attempted murder, felonious assault, domestic violence and operating a vehicle under the influence.

On Monday at around 2:30 p.m., troopers initially stopped what they believed to be a disabled commercial motor vehicle on I-77 near Fohl Road.

While speaking with the driver, troopers located a woman hiding in the cab of the truck. Troopers said the woman has visible injuries to her head, face and hands.

It was later determined the two were married and the victim had sustained the injuries after being attacked with a knife and a blunt object, according to the release.

The woman was transported to a hospital by EMS and later released to family.

Roberts is currently being held in the Stark County Jail.
